Help Desk Team Leader Average Salary in United Arab Emirates


A person working as a Help Desk Team Leader in United Arab Emirates will on average earn $53573 per year (pre-tax value). Salary is provided in USD ($/dollar) value.

Below is a break-down of yearly, monthly, weekly and hourly rate.

Rate Type Amount (USD)
Yearly salary $53,573.00
Weekly salary $1,030.25
Daily salary $146.78
Hourly salary $18.35

Year over year increase in salary is registered at around 4%

Average salary in United Arab Emirates is approximately 48950$

This means help desk team leader salary is above average!

Job Information for: help desk team leader

Job Industry: information technology

Description: A help desk team leader is responsible for overseeing and managing a team of help desk technicians who provide technical support to users within an organization. They ensure that the team meets service level agreements, resolves technical issues efficiently, and provides excellent customer service. The team leader sets performance goals, assigns tasks, and provides guidance and training to team members. They also handle escalated customer complaints and collaborate with other departments to improve processes and systems. Additionally, they analyze help desk metrics, generate reports, and make recommendations for improvement. Excellent communication skills, problem-solving abilities, and technical knowledge are essential for this role.
